Estrogen receptor-mediated neuroprotection: The role of the Alzheimer’s disease-related gene seladin-1
Experimental evidence supports a protective role of estrogen in the brain. According to the fact that Alzheimer's disease (AD) is more common in postmenopausal women, estrogen treatment has been proposed. This work describes a novel mechanism of neuroprotection by simvastatin: the modulation of seladin-1, an enzyme involved in Alzheimer's disease. Genomic and proteomic studies in human neuronal cells showed seladin-1 production to be increased in a dose- and time-dependent manner by simvastatin. This was confirmed in mice by immunohistochemical and qRT-PCR studies.
